How to Use the Writing Checks Worksheet PDF
Using the writing checks worksheet pdf involves a step-by-step approach to ensure users grasp the fundamentals of check writing and balancing a checkbook. Below is a typical procedure to maximize the utility of the worksheet:
-
Review the Examples: Start by examining the sample transactions provided. Understanding these examples prepares users to replicate similar transactions with ease.
-
Fill Out Checks: Begin by filling out checks for various purposes, such as paying bills or donations. Each check should include critical details such as the date, payee name, amount in figures and words, and the user’s signature.
-
Record Transactions: Input each check into the check registry section of the worksheet. Record the check number, date, payee, and amount to maintain an accurate log of all financial transactions.
-
Calculate Balances: After recording, calculate the updated account balance by adjusting the previous balance with the new transaction details.
-
Answer Questions: Complete any accompanying questions designed to assess understanding of the transaction impacts on the account balance.
The iterative nature of this exercise builds skills necessary for personal finance management by reinforcing the habit of accurate record-keeping.

Important Terms Related to Writing Checks Worksheet PDF
Understanding specific terms related to the writing checks worksheet pdf is crucial for interpreting and completing the document accurately:
-
Payee: The individual or organization to whom the check is written.
-
Signature: The authorized sign-off by the check creator, affirming the transaction's legitimacy.
-
Check Amount: The sum of money to be transferred, written both numerically and as words to ensure clarity.
-
Registry: The log that records each transaction, essential for tracking and balancing accounts.
These terms are integral to executing the worksheet tasks properly, as they form the core knowledge needed for effective check writing and financial tracking.
